The Nature of Earthquakes
Earthquakes occur when there is a sudden release of energy in the Earth’s crust, causing ground motion. This release can happen along faults in a seismic zone, where tectonic plates meet.
The intensity of ground motion can vary based on several factors, including the earthquake’s magnitude, depth, and distance from the epicenter. In areas with higher seismic activity, such as California, understanding these nuances becomes essential.
Homeowners should be aware that frequent tremors can weaken structures, making them more susceptible to damage during major seismic events.
Risks to Plumbing Systems
The impacts of seismic activity on plumbing systems can be severe. Natural gas lines are particularly vulnerable during an earthquake. Ground motion may cause breaks or disconnections in these lines, leading to leaks.
Furthermore, plumbing pipes can shift or rupture, creating water damage and contributing to safety hazards. Recognizing these risks highlights the importance of preventive measures, such as installing earthquake valves.

How Earthquake Valves Work
Earthquake valves are crucial for safeguarding plumbing systems during seismic events. These valves detect ground movements and automatically shut off gas lines, minimizing the risk of leaks and potential fires. Understanding how these valves operate can help you appreciate their role in disaster preparedness.
Types of Seismic Valves
Seismic valves come in several types, primarily categorized based on their mechanism of action.
- Automatic Gas Shutoff Valves: These valves act immediately upon detecting motion, cutting off gas supply in response to ground shaking.
- Excess Flow Valves: Designed to reduce gas flow in case of a significant leak, they help prevent hazardous situations.
- Motion Sensors: Some systems integrate motion sensors to trigger the shutting off of gas lines when movement exceeds a specified threshold.
Each type offers unique benefits tailored for different environments and requirements, making it essential to choose the right valve for your home.
Mechanism of Operation
The operational process of earthquake valves is straightforward yet effective.
When seismic activity begins, sensors within the valve detect vibrations. The valve responds by closing rapidly, typically within seconds, to stop gas flow. This rapid response is vital in preventing gas leaks that could lead to fires or explosions.
Many modern valves feature a reset mechanism that allows you to resume gas service after an event. The simplicity of this operation ensures that homeowners can maintain safety with minimal effort. Earthquake Valve as a Safety Device
An earthquake valve is a crucial safety device designed to protect your property from potential hazards during seismic activity. This valve automatically shuts off the gas supply when it senses ground movement, preventing uncontrolled gas leaks. You should have this system installed between your gas meter and the main supply lines.
Regular inspections and maintenance of the earthquake valve help ensure its functionality. For added safety, you might also want to consider linking the valve to your home safety system, which could alert you in case of gas detection while you’re away. Routine Maintenance and Testing
Routine maintenance is key to ensuring your earthquake valve remains operational. Schedule regular inspections with a professional plumber to check for any wear or damage. This includes checking for leaks and proper alignment within the system.
Testing the valve should occur at least once a year. A plumber will simulate seismic activity to confirm the valve activates correctly. Consistent maintenance helps prevent unexpected failures during an earthquake, ensuring your household is protected.
